Paris Jackson slams social media trolls

LOS ANGELES, July 30: King of Pop Michael Jackson’s daughter Paris took to Instagram to address social media trolls and asked her followers to stop hate.
In her post, the 18-year-old said she is aware that not all followers are her fans.
“I would very much like to address something here.I realize that a very very large portion of the followers I have are people that highly dislike me and very much enjoy to write negative things about what I say and do.
“It’s alarming and a little scary how a small thing I do blows up because the negative followers try to micromanage and control what I do,” Paris wrote.
She then addressed users, who she has blocked, defending her right to report people for hurtful behavior. “I had reason, and I clarified it.I stand by that.
“Further more if anyone that doesn’t like me is following this account, I urge you to please just unfollow. If what I do angers you I really don’t want you to see it because that just encourages more anger and hate. I try to do everything I can with love and humor.”
“Once again, if you don’t like me please don’t waste your time on me,” she concluded.
Paris also took to Twitter to comment on the topic, revealing that even her boyfriend’s family was being harassed.
“People are literally making fake accounts to harass and bully the mother of my boyfriend. How far is this going to go? Makes me sick,” she tweeted.
This isn’t the first time the teenager has had to defend herself from online haters. Last month, she slammed trolls who tried to bully and harass her into writing a Father’s Day post. (PTI)
